Movies asks 2, 3, 12, 19, 23
2. A movie you think is underrated- i know it got a lot of attention during awards season in 2015, but The Revenant! Its such a beautiful film with its use of all natural lighting (thank u Chivo) and the acting in it is superb. Im glad Leo got an oscar for it and i wish Tom Hardy would've won for best supporting actor as well. Also Domhnall did amazing and he was still hot despite it being the 1800s.
3. A movie you think is overrated
Tbh the first Blade Runner. Its known more as a 'cult classic' but i really didnt care for it. The pacing was all over the place and i thought it got even weirder near the end with the villain suddenly having a change of "heart" or whatever u call it. I just had a hard time enjoying it aside from the visuals. I was confused the entire time tbh.
12. A performance you think is underrated
FOR SURE Javier Bardem as Raoul Silva in Skyfall (2012). One of the best villains of all time and one of the most captivating performances in a Bond film. He scared me to death but also intrigued me. I liked his almost mother/son relationship with M and how he almost saw James as the 'favorite' sibling metaphorically. He was very smart and cunning and his quips were also top tier. You understand why he was after M but he still felt evil too. Im still pissed he was snubbed for an oscar.
